Descrizione

In this insightful report, the authors delve into the process of validating a stress survey tailored for individuals with autism and other developmental disabilities. Their research highlights the unique challenges faced by this population when it comes to assessing stress levels, underscoring the need for specialized tools that accurately reflect their experiences.

Through systematic evaluation, the team aims to ensure that the survey not only captures the nuances of stress but also enhances support for those affected. The validation process involves rigorous testing and analysis, providing a reliable instrument that can inform interventions and improve quality of life.

By focusing on the intersection of autism and developmental disabilities with stress assessment, this work paves the way for further research and development in this crucial area, fostering a deeper understanding of emotional wellbeing within these communities.
